Parade registration starts next week

Registration starts Friday June 1 for entries in the 2007 July 4th parade in Peachtree City.

City residents, churches, service organizations and businesses can register for free starting June 1. A week later all other Fayette County residents, churches, service organizations can register for $25 and Fayette County businesses can register for $50.

No out-of-county entries will be allowed to enter, but a few are being invited such as Delta Airlines, which adds character to the parade with its inflatable airborne plane that is escorted along the route.

This year’s parade starts at 9 a.m. July 4, starting on Peachtree Parkway near Braelinn Golf Course.

The parade will go north on the parkway until it reaches McIntosh Trail, where it will turn left before dispersing at Huddleston Elementary School and the McIntosh Trail recreation complex.

As always the city’s annual fireworks display will begin at dusk. The city is asking residents not to lay out blankets, chairs and the like until 3 p.m. that day in a bid to protect the grass.

The unattended blankets have drawn complaints from citizens who show up at a more reasonable time to find a spot but have difficulty doing so because of the already “staked out” viewing areas.
